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Fix user_guide.rst doc python example issues #27

Merged
merged 1 commit into from
Jun 20, 2024

Conversation

jaebaek
Copy link
Contributor

@jaebaek jaebaek commented Jun 8, 2024

  1. Without the guard if __name__ == "__main__": in the main module, the Bert example in the docs/public/user_guide.rst, users can get the following error:
2024-06-06 23:18:54.180 | ERROR    | pybuda.run.impl:_start_device_processes:1183 - Process spawn error:
        An attempt has been made to start a new process before the
        current process has finished its bootstrapping phase.

        This probably means that you are not using fork to start your
        child processes and you have forgotten to use the proper idiom
        in the main module:

            if __name__ == '__main__':
                freeze_support()
                ...

        The "freeze_support()" line can be omitted if the program
        is not going to be frozen to produce an executable.
  1. Missing '"' in the string.

1. Without the guard `if __name__ == "__main__":` in the main module,
the Bert example in the `docs/public/user_guide.rst`, users can get the
following error:
```
2024-06-06 23:18:54.180 | ERROR    | pybuda.run.impl:_start_device_processes:1183 - Process spawn error:
        An attempt has been made to start a new process before the
        current process has finished its bootstrapping phase.

        This probably means that you are not using fork to start your
        child processes and you have forgotten to use the proper idiom
        in the main module:

            if __name__ == '__main__':
                freeze_support()
                ...

        The "freeze_support()" line can be omitted if the program
        is not going to be frozen to produce an executable.
```

2. Missing '"' in the string.
@milank94 milank94 added bug Something isn't working documentation Improvements or additions to documentation labels Jun 10, 2024
Copy link
Contributor

@staylorTT staylorTT left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Reviewed the PR internally it looks good. I will work to get this merged in. Thanks for your contributions!

@vmilosevic vmilosevic merged commit e529d00 into tenstorrent:main Jun 20, 2024
1 check failed
buxiangqimingle233 pushed a commit to buxiangqimingle233/tt-buda that referenced this pull request Sep 29, 2024
Fix user_guide.rst doc python example issues
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ug Something isn't working documentation Improvements or additions to documentation
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ants